* this way arround some compilers like the casts better.
[citadel.git] / webcit / siteconfig.c
index 5963b010f3e55f7aedf3a298c50408a71dc13f76..0ab15744aadd314508b24dbd2094fd59e784909e 100644 (file)
@@ -500,7 +500,8 @@ void display_siteconfig(void)
                        int z;
                        long len;
                        char this_zone[128];
-                       char *ZName, *ZNamee;
+                       char *ZName;
+                       void *ZNamee;
                        HashList *List;
                        HashPos  *it;
 
@@ -519,9 +520,9 @@ void display_siteconfig(void)
                        }
                        SortByHashKey(List);
                        it = GetNewHashPos();
-                       while (GetNextHashPos(List, it, &len, &ZName, (void**)&ZNamee)) {
+                       while (GetNextHashPos(List, it, &len, &ZName, &ZNamee)) {
                                sprintf(&general[strlen(general)], "<option %s value=\"%s\">%s</option>\n",
-                                       (!strcasecmp(ZName, buf) ? "selected" : ""),
+                                       (!strcasecmp((char*)ZName, buf) ? "selected" : ""),
                                        ZName, ZName
                                );
                        }